Abstract
The utility model discloses a combined charging seat for engineering machinery, which is characterized by comprising a plug, wherein a signal indicator lamp is arranged around the plug, a USB output interface and a cigar lighter female seat are arranged on the plug side by side, and a connecting circuit of the plug is connected through a nylon plastic corrugated pipe. The utility model provides a combined charging seat with a brand-new size, which is novel in style, integrates a cigar lighter female seat and a USB output charging port together and is convenient for a driver to operate.
Description
Technical Field
The utility model relates to a combined charging seat for engineering machinery, and belongs to the field of engineering machinery.
Background
At present, electronic equipment such as a mobile phone and the like is widely used in daily life, and an engineering machinery driver is no exception, but the electronic equipment cannot be close to a power supply for a long time in outdoor operation, and the endurance problem of the electronic equipment is very critical, so that the installation of a combined charging seat in a cab is particularly important for charging the electronic equipment. But the interface that charges is many types now, can't reach the unity, and single USB interface has been unable to satisfy all needs of charging, utilizes the female seat of cigar lighter to expand more charge modes.
Disclosure of Invention
The technical problem to be solved by the utility model is as follows: the combined charging seat with the brand new size is provided, and the cigar lighter female seat and the USB output charging port are integrated together, so that the operation of a driver is facilitated.
In order to solve the technical problem, the technical scheme of the utility model is to provide a combined charging seat for engineering machinery, which is characterized by comprising a plug, wherein signal indicating lamps are arranged around the plug, a USB output interface and a cigar lighter female seat are arranged on the plug side by side, and connecting circuits of the plug are connected through a nylon plastic corrugated pipe.
Preferably, the USB output interface and cigarette lighter female seat outside all be equipped with the plastics visor, prevent to splash water and dust, the rear side is left the pencil and is connected with the main pencil to there is the bellows protection, avoid dragging and draw and lead to the pencil to destroy, there is convex buckle plug both sides for fix interior plaque behind the driver's cabin.
Preferably, the USB output interface is provided with two charging ports, namely, a fast charging port and a slow charging port, which are respectively 5V, 2.1A, 5V and 1A, and the circuit of the USB output interface is provided with an output short-circuit protection, an output closing, a reverse polarity protection, an overheat protection, an overcharge protection, an overload protection, an overcurrent protection and a circuit device for preventing the power of the electric equipment from burning off the circuit of the whole vehicle.
Compared with the prior charging seat, the utility model has the following beneficial effects:
1. the double USB output ports are respectively a 5V1A slow charging interface and a 5V2.1A fast charging interface, so that different requirements are met;
2. the cigarette lighter female seat outputs 24V120W, and a vehicle-mounted inverter can be configured, so that 24V direct current is converted into 220V alternating current to provide a power supply for small-power electric appliances;
3. when the voltage of the storage battery is higher than 23.5V, the blue indicator lamp around the interface is normally on to indicate that the charging seat can normally work, and when the voltage of the storage battery is lower than 23.5V, the blue indicator lamp around the interface of the charging socket is automatically turned off to indicate that the charging seat can not normally work, and the charging seat is automatically powered off, so that the service life of the storage battery can be prolonged, and the problem that the whole vehicle can not normally start due to serious power shortage of the storage battery is avoided;
4. install the interior plaque behind the driver's cabin, space utilization improves, and the size of a dimension designs more rationally.

Detailed Description
In order to make the utility model more comprehensible, preferred embodiments are described in detail below with reference to the accompanying drawings.
As shown in the figures to 3, the combined charging seat for the engineering machinery is characterized by comprising a plug 1, signal indicating lamps are arranged around the plug 1, a USB output interface 2 and a cigarette lighter female seat 3 are arranged on the plug 1 side by side, a connecting circuit of the plug 1 is connected with the cigarette lighter female seat 3 through a nylon plastic corrugated pipe 4, plastic protective covers are arranged on the outer sides of the USB output interface 2 and the cigarette lighter female seat 3 to prevent water and dust from splashing, a wire harness is left on the rear side to be connected with a main wire harness and protected by the corrugated pipe to avoid damage of the wire harness caused by pulling, convex buckles are arranged on two sides of the plug 1 and used for fixing a rear interior trim panel of a cab, the USB output interface 2 is provided with two charging ports for quick charging and slow charging, namely 5V, 2.1A, 5V and 1A, output short-circuit protection is arranged on a circuit of the USB output interface 2, output closing, reverse polarity protection, overheat protection and overcharge protection, Overload protection, overcurrent protection and circuit devices for preventing the electric equipment from burning off the circuit of the whole vehicle due to overhigh power.
According to the utility model, two USB charging ports and a cigarette lighter female seat are integrated together, the arrangement is compact, the space is saved, the operation space is sufficiently reserved, and the plastic protective covers are arranged on the charging ports and the outer side of the cigarette lighter, so that water and dust are prevented from splashing. The rear side is provided with a wire harness connected with the main wire harness and protected by a corrugated pipe, so that the wire harness is prevented from being damaged due to pulling. Convex buckles are arranged on two sides of the charging seat and used for being fixed on a rear interior trim panel of a cab.
The USB charging port is respectively charged rapidly and slowly, and is respectively 5V2.1A and 5V 1A; the contact surface of the copper sheet at the bottom of the cigarette lighter female seat is a positive electrode, the contact surface of the copper sheet around the inner side is a negative electrode, the accessory is inserted when a charging port is expanded, and the output parameter is 24V 120W. When the two interfaces work, the blue indicator light is on, when the voltage is lower than 23.5V, the working indicator light is off, and the charging seat does not work.
As shown in fig. 4, the USB output interface and the cigar lighter socket both take electricity from a 24V power supply of the storage battery, and the input and output filter capacitors function to store energy, filter and stabilize voltage; the integrated circuit is provided with a precise comparator, and once the current is reduced, the power supply is cut off through a power supply chip so as to achieve the purpose of maintaining the voltage of the storage battery to meet the starting requirement of the whole vehicle; thermal protection, overload, overcharge and constant current diodes are used as protection mechanisms of the charging interface; the light emitting diode is lighted when the charging interface works. The integrated circuit of the cigarette lighter socket and the USB output interface are separated, voltage stabilization and amplification circuit effects are achieved, and finally a user gets electricity from the cigarette lighter socket.
